Our approach
We take on most of our personal injury cases on no win no fee basis (either CFA or DBA). We offer a free initial consultation service for every case. This is followed by an in-dept analysis for cases with prospects. Please note that we only take cases on CFA or DBA which have good chance of success. Our clients also get the option to engage us on fixed fee or hourly rate basis. For cases that do not qualify for CFA or DBA, we offer detailed advice on merit and costs to help our clients decide.
We can assist our clients in getting after the event insurance (ATEs) to secure their liabilities against costs.
We seek to resolve our personal injury cases through negotiation and other out of court methods, so that matters can be resolved expeditiously and with minimal costs. If, however, a case proceeds to litigation, our highly skilled and experienced litigation team make sure that the case is dealt with in the most efficient way.
We put a lot of effort in assessment and negotiation so that we can achieve the best possible outcome for our clients.
